Figure 4. (a) Stereo view of MIDAS motif comparison for ligand-bound and ligand-free conformations. The metal ions are shown in the same color as the main-chain ribbons, and the water molecules are in blue. The ligand-free closed conformation, in the presence of Mg^2+ for α2β1 I-domain (yellow) is superposed on the ligand-bound open conformation of α2β1 Id-main (cyan) and the ligand-free open-like conformation of C2a (magenta). A Glu residue from the ligand collagen completes the coordination of Mg in α2β1 I-domain open conformation. (b) Stereo view of a detailed comparison of the MIDAS structures of C2a (magenta) and Bb (yellow). The metal atom of C2a is shown as a silver ball and that of Bb is shown as yellow ball. Continuous thin lines indicate the metal coordination of C2a (magenta) and Bb (yellow). Water molecules are shown in blue. Figure 4.
